FAQs

ReBoot stands as a landmark achievement in early computer-animated television, pushing the boundaries of what was technically feasible for broadcast at the time. Its fully CGI production was revolutionary, influencing subsequent animated series and demonstrating the potential of this emerging technology. The series' visual aesthetic and storytelling laid groundwork for a new era of digital storytelling, making it a significant cultural touchstone for animation history.
